This booklet is aimed at Level 2 Pass and above pupils, it can be adapted for level 1 is needed. LAA has been broken down into manageable tasks, which will also help with marking!
Task 1:
- Introduction does not meet any specific criteria, but will help pupils understand the aim of the component.
Task 2:
- Meets level 2 criteria as pupils are completing tasks using evidence that may be semi structured or unstructured, using researched or analysed information, showing understanding, problem solving and using own judgement. (PG 36 in spec)
Task 3:
- Meet level 2 P1 and P2 criteria as learners describe the growth and development of an individual across the three life stages in each of the PIES categories.
- They also explain how relevant factors may have affected the growth and development of an individual.
- They/you will need to check that they have included Factors from each of the three categories given in the Teaching content must be included, with at least two each from physical and social/cultural.
Task 4:
- Meets level 2 M1 and part of D1 as learners compare the relevant factors that may have affected the growth and development of an individual across the three life stages, examining the benefits or otherwise of each factor presented in terms of what had the greatest to the least effect.
- They/you will need to check that they have included Factors from each of the three categories given in the Teaching content must be included, with at least two each from physical and social/cultural.
- Part of D1 is achieved through learners carefully considering relevant factors and how their impact changes over time
Task 5:
- Meets level 2 D1 as learners assess which factors are most important at each of the three chosen life stages. They are independent and must cover the 2 physical, 2 social and cultural and 1 economic factor to secure D1.
